Projection comparison chart: overlays two percentile-band //! envelopes - a "then" projection (computed as of a past snapshot) //! and a "now" projection - so the viewer can see how the forecast //! envelope shifted between the two dates. //! //! Both projections are aligned at year 0 (each one's own start), so //! the x-axis is "years from the projection's start" and the overlay //! answers "how did my projected envelope move between then and now?". //! //! Each side draws a light p10-p90 fill plus a solid median line in //! its own hue (then = `theme.info` / cyan, now = `theme.accent` / //! purple), keyed by a small top-left "then"/"now" color legend. //! //!
